Nearby Attractions

With the Gippsland Lakes on your doorstep, get out and make a splash! The adjacent foreshore area provides sheltered, sandy access to the lake, ideal for a paddle or a swim for all ages.

Bring your canoe, kayak, paddle board or boat to venture out and explore the Gippsland Lakes, islands and inland waterways. We also have a number of kayaks available for guests to use on a complimentary basis.

Drop a fishing line off the jetty and try your luck at bagging a bream, flathead, whiting or salmon for dinner. Or just sit back with a glass of wine and gaze at the boats as they go by (in winter months be sure to keep an eye out for our resident dolphins!).

You can bring your bike and experience the world class mountain bike trails within nearby Colquhoun forest, around 5 minutes drive from our Retreat.

The Metung Hot Springs is situated less than 10 minutes drive from our property, offering year round bathing in geothermal pools, and a range of wellness experiences.

Pack a picnic and drive a few minutes to Nyerimilang Park, a historic homestead set in beautiful gardens with clifftop views of the Lakes system and scenic walking tracks.

Head to a nearby farmers' market (held in Metung on the second Saturday each month). Whilst in Metung, stretch your legs on the boardwalk that hugs the lake.

Grab some fish and chips and sit and watch the fishing fleets returning at Lakes Entrance. Buy some fresh caught seafood straight off the fishing trawlers and bring it back to your cabin for a seafood feast.
